//! Integration tests for the `allowColumnDefaults` writer feature.

use std::collections::HashMap;
use std::fs;
use std::path::Path;
use std::sync::Arc;

use delta_kernel::actions::{MAX_VALUES, MIN_VALUES, NULL_COUNT};
use delta_kernel::arrow::array::{ArrayRef, Int32Array, Int64Array, StringArray};
use delta_kernel::arrow::record_batch::RecordBatch;
use delta_kernel::committer::FileSystemCommitter;
use delta_kernel::engine::arrow_conversion::{TryFromArrow as _, TryIntoArrow as _};
use delta_kernel::engine::arrow_data::{ArrowEngineData, EngineDataArrowExt as _};
use delta_kernel::expressions::{ColumnName, Scalar};
use delta_kernel::parquet::arrow::arrow_reader::ParquetRecordBatchReaderBuilder;
use delta_kernel::schema::{
    schema, schema_ref, ArrayType, ColumnMetadataKey, DataType, MetadataValue, SchemaRef,
    StructField, StructType,
};
use delta_kernel::table_features::{
    get_any_level_column_physical_name, ColumnMappingMode, TableFeature,
};
use delta_kernel::transaction::create_table::create_table as kernel_create_table;
use delta_kernel::transaction::data_layout::DataLayout;
use delta_kernel::{DeltaResult, Engine, Snapshot};
use rstest::rstest;
use test_utils::delta_kernel_default_engine::executor::tokio::TokioBackgroundExecutor;
use test_utils::delta_kernel_default_engine::DefaultEngine;
use test_utils::{
    copy_directory, create_default_engine, create_table, engine_store_setup, get_column,
    insert_data, read_actions_from_commit, read_scan, resolve_field, schema_with_column_defaults,
    test_read, test_table_setup, test_table_setup_mt, write_batch_to_table, LoggingTest,
};
use url::Url;

use crate::common::write_utils::load_existing_single_file_checkpoint_path;

async fn setup_unpartitioned_table(
    name: &str,
    schema: SchemaRef,
    writer_features: Vec<&str>,
) -> Result<(DefaultEngine<TokioBackgroundExecutor>, Url),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
    let (store, engine, table_location) = engine_store_setup(name, None);
    let table_url = create_table(
        store,
        table_location,
        schema,
        &[],
        true,
        vec![],
        writer_features,
    )
    .await?;
    Ok((engine, table_url))
}

fn add_column_defaults_feature_commit(
    table_path: &Path,
    version: u64,
    schema: Option<&StructType>,
) -> Result<(),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
    let initial_commit =
        fs::read_to_string(table_path.join("_delta_log/00000000000000000000.json"))?;
    let mut actions = initial_commit
        .lines()
        .map(serde_json::from_str::<serde_json::Value>)
        .collect::<Result<Vec<_>, _>>()?;
    let protocol = {
        let protocol = actions
            .iter_mut()
            .find(|action| action.get("protocol").is_some())
            .expect("initial commit must contain a protocol action");
        let writer_features = protocol["protocol"]["writerFeatures"]
            .as_array_mut()
            .expect("writer v7 protocol must contain writerFeatures");
        writer_features.push(serde_json::json!("allowColumnDefaults"));
        protocol.clone()
    };

    let metadata = {
        let metadata = actions
            .iter_mut()
            .find(|action| action.get("metaData").is_some())
            .expect("initial commit must contain a metadata action");
        if let Some(schema) = schema {
            metadata["metaData"]["schemaString"] =
                serde_json::json!(serde_json::to_string(schema)?);
        }
        metadata.clone()
    };

    let commit = format!(
        "{}\n{}\n",
        serde_json::to_string(&protocol)?,
        serde_json::to_string(&metadata)?,
    );
    fs::write(
        table_path.join(format!("_delta_log/{version:020}.json")),
        commit,
    )?;
    Ok(())
}

fn assert_top_level_default(
    snapshot: &Arc<Snapshot>,
    engine: &dyn Engine,
    column: &str,
    expected: Scalar,
) -> DeltaResult<()> {
    let txn = snapshot
        .clone()
        .transaction(Box::new(FileSystemCommitter::new()), engine)?;
    assert_eq!(
        txn.top_level_column_defaults()?[column].to_scalar()?,
        Some(expected)
    );
    Ok(())
}

fn assert_no_column_default_metadata(schema: &StructType, path: &[&str]) {
    let display = path.join(".");
    let field = resolve_field(schema, path)
        .unwrap_or_else(|error| panic!("checkpoint schema must contain '{display}': {error}"));
    assert!(
        field
            .get_config_value(&ColumnMetadataKey::CurrentDefault)
            .is_none(),
        "checkpoint-derived field '{display}' must not carry CURRENT_DEFAULT metadata",
    );
}

fn assert_checkpoint_parsed_columns_have_no_column_defaults(
    checkpoint_schema: &StructType,
    data_column: &str,
    partition_column: &str,
) {
    assert_no_column_default_metadata(
        checkpoint_schema,
        &["add", "partitionValues_parsed", partition_column],
    );
    for stats_field in [MIN_VALUES, MAX_VALUES, NULL_COUNT] {
        assert_no_column_default_metadata(
            checkpoint_schema,
            &["add", "stats_parsed", stats_field, data_column],
        );
    }
}

// TODO(#2630): Allow create table to support column defaults
#[test]
fn test_create_table_rejects_col_defaults() -> DeltaResult<()> {
    let (_temp_dir, table_path, engine) = test_table_setup()?;
    let schema = schema_ref! { nullable "id": LONG };

    let err = kernel_create_table(&table_path, schema, "Test/1.0")
        .with_table_properties([("delta.feature.allowColumnDefaults", "supported")])
        .build(engine.as_ref(), Box::new(FileSystemCommitter::new()))
        .expect_err("kernel create_table must reject allowColumnDefaults")
        .to_string();
    assert!(
        err.contains("allowColumnDefaults"),
        "error must name the unsupported feature; got: {err}",
    );
    Ok(())
}

#[tokio::test]
async fn test_blind_append_to_column_defaults_table_is_supported(
) -> Result<(),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
    let schema = schema_ref! {
        nullable "id": LONG,
        nullable "name": STRING,
    };

    let (store, engine, table_location) = engine_store_setup("test_table_col_defaults", None);
    // Use the JSON helper instead of the kernel `create_table` builder because the
    // latter does not whitelist this feature in `ALLOWED_DELTA_FEATURES`.
    let table_url = create_table(
        store.clone(),
        table_location,
        schema.clone(),
        &[],                         /* partition_columns */
        true,                        /* use_37_protocol */
        vec![],                      /* reader_features */
        vec!["allowColumnDefaults"], /* writer_features */
    )
    .await?;
    let engine = Arc::new(engine);

    let snapshot = Snapshot::builder_for(table_url.clone()).build(engine.as_ref())?;
    let writer_features = snapshot
        .table_configuration()
        .protocol()
        .writer_features()
        .expect("writer_features must be present on a writer v7 table");
    assert!(
        writer_features.contains(&TableFeature::AllowColumnDefaults),
        "writer_features must include AllowColumnDefaults; got {writer_features:?}",
    );

    // Blind-append a small batch. No column has a `CURRENT_DEFAULT` yet, so this is a plain
    // append; we only assert the feature does not block the write path.
    let columns: Vec<ArrayRef> = vec![
        Arc::new(Int64Array::from(vec![1, 2, 3])),
        Arc::new(StringArray::from(vec!["a", "b", "c"])),
    ];
    assert!(insert_data(snapshot, &engine, columns.clone())
        .await?
        .is_committed());

    // Round-trip read.
    let data = RecordBatch::try_new(Arc::new(schema.as_ref().try_into_arrow()?), columns)?;
    test_read(&ArrowEngineData::new(data), &table_url, engine)?;

    Ok(())
}

#[rstest]
#[case::unpartitioned("unpartitioned", &[])]
#[case::partitioned("partitioned", &["p"])]
#[tokio::test]
async fn write_state_acknowledgement_depends_on_column_defaults(
    #[case] label: &str,
    #[case] partition_columns: &[&str],
    #[values(false, true)] has_default: bool,
) -> Result<(),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
    let base = schema! {
        nullable "c": INTEGER,
        nullable "p": INTEGER,
    };
    let schema = if has_default {
        schema_with_column_defaults(&base, HashMap::from([("c", "42")]))?
    } else {
        Arc::new(base)
    };
    let table_name = format!("write_state_ack_{label}_{has_default}");
    let (store, engine, table_location) = engine_store_setup(&table_name, None);
    let table_url = create_table(
        store,
        table_location,
        schema,
        partition_columns,
        true,
        vec![],
        vec!["allowColumnDefaults"],
    )
    .await?;

    let snapshot = Snapshot::builder_for(table_url).build(&engine)?;
    let mut txn = snapshot.transaction(Box::new(FileSystemCommitter::new()), &engine)?;

    let defaults = txn.top_level_column_defaults()?;
    if has_default {
        assert_eq!(defaults["c"].to_scalar()?, Some(Scalar::Integer(42)));
    } else {
        assert!(defaults.is_empty());
    }
    drop(defaults);

    let partition_values = HashMap::from([("p".to_string(), Scalar::Integer(7))]);
    if has_default {
        let error = txn
            .write_state()
            .expect_err("inspecting defaults must not implicitly acknowledge them");
        assert!(matches!(
            &error,
            delta_kernel::Error::InvalidTransactionState(_)
        ));
        assert!(error.to_string().contains("ack_column_defaults"));

        txn.ack_column_defaults();
    }
    let write_state = txn.write_state()?;
    if partition_columns.is_empty() {
        write_state.unpartitioned_write_context()?;
    } else {
        write_state.partitioned_write_context(partition_values)?;
    }

    Ok(())
}

/// On an `icebergCompatV3` table, a default kernel cannot verify as a literal produces a
/// warning rather than an error, so the snapshot loads and a DML transaction constructs.
#[rstest]
#[case::non_literal(
    "non_literal",
    DataType::TIMESTAMP,
    "current_timestamp()",
    "could not verify"
)]
#[case::unparsable_non_primitive(
    "non_primitive",
    DataType::from(ArrayType::new(DataType::INTEGER, true)),
    "ARRAY(1)",
    "could not verify"
)]
#[tokio::test]
async fn test_load_and_write_tolerate_v3_unverifiable_default(
    #[case] label: &str,
    #[case] field_type: DataType,
    #[case] default_sql: &str,
    #[case] warning_text: &str,
) -> Result<(),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
    let base = schema! { nullable "c": (field_type) };
    let schema = schema_with_column_defaults(&base, HashMap::from([("c", default_sql)]))?;

    let (engine, table_url) = setup_unpartitioned_table(
        &format!("test_v3_tolerates_{label}"),
        schema,
        vec!["allowColumnDefaults", "icebergCompatV3"],
    )
    .await?;

    // Read: the snapshot loads despite the unverifiable default.
    let snapshot = Snapshot::builder_for(table_url).build(&engine)?;

    let logging = LoggingTest::new();
    snapshot.transaction(Box::new(FileSystemCommitter::new()), &engine)?;
    assert!(
        logging.logs().contains(warning_text),
        "logs: {}",
        logging.logs()
    );

    Ok(())
}

/// A non-string `CURRENT_DEFAULT` value is corrupt and rejected at snapshot load. Built by
/// hand because `schema_with_column_defaults` only writes string values.
#[tokio::test]
async fn test_load_rejects_non_string_column_default() -> Result<(),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
    let field = StructField::nullable("c", DataType::INTEGER).add_metadata([(
        ColumnMetadataKey::CurrentDefault.as_ref().to_string(),
        MetadataValue::Number(7),
    )]);
    let schema = schema_ref! { (field) };

    let (engine, table_url) = setup_unpartitioned_table(
        "test_load_rejects_non_string_default",
        schema,
        vec!["allowColumnDefaults"],
    )
    .await?;

    let err = Snapshot::builder_for(table_url)
        .build(&engine)
        .expect_err("a non-string CURRENT_DEFAULT must be rejected at load")
        .to_string();
    assert!(err.contains("non-string"), "got: {err}");

    Ok(())
}

/// Orphaned column-default metadata (a `CURRENT_DEFAULT` without the `allowColumnDefaults`
/// feature) is tolerated: the snapshot loads and a write context builds without error.
#[tokio::test]
async fn test_load_and_write_allow_orphan_default() -> Result<(),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
    let base = schema! { nullable "c": INTEGER };
    let schema = schema_with_column_defaults(&base, HashMap::from([("c", "42")]))?;

    let (engine, table_url) =
        setup_unpartitioned_table("test_load_orphan_default", schema, vec![]).await?;

    // Read: snapshot loads despite the orphaned metadata.
    let snapshot = Snapshot::builder_for(table_url).build(&engine)?;

    // Write: a write state and context build without error.
    let txn = snapshot.transaction(Box::new(FileSystemCommitter::new()), &engine)?;
    assert!(
        txn.top_level_column_defaults()?.is_empty(),
        "orphaned defaults must not be surfaced without allowColumnDefaults",
    );
    txn.write_state()?.unpartitioned_write_context()?;

    Ok(())
}

#[rstest]
#[case::null_default("null", "NULL", None)]
#[case::non_null_default("non_null", "'value'", Some("must be NULL"))]
#[tokio::test]
async fn test_variant_column_default_validation_at_snapshot_load(
    #[case] label: &str,
    #[case] default_sql: &str,
    #[case] expected_error: Option<&str>,
) -> Result<(),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
    let variant_type = DataType::unshredded_variant();
    let base = schema! { nullable "v": (variant_type) };
    let schema = schema_with_column_defaults(&base, HashMap::from([("v", default_sql)]))?;

    let (store, engine, table_location) =
        engine_store_setup(&format!("test_variant_default_{label}"), None);
    let table_url = create_table(
        store,
        table_location,
        schema,
        &[],
        true,
        vec!["variantType"],
        vec!["variantType", "allowColumnDefaults"],
    )
    .await?;

    match expected_error {
        Some(expected_error) => {
            let error = Snapshot::builder_for(table_url)
                .build(&engine)
                .expect_err("a non-NULL Variant default must be rejected at snapshot load")
                .to_string();
            assert!(error.contains(expected_error), "got: {error}");
        }
        None => {
            let snapshot = Snapshot::builder_for(table_url).build(&engine)?;
            let txn = snapshot.transaction(Box::new(FileSystemCommitter::new()), &engine)?;
            let defaults = txn.top_level_column_defaults()?;
            let column_default = &defaults["v"];
            assert_eq!(column_default.raw_sql(), default_sql);
            assert!(
                column_default
                    .to_scalar()?
                    .is_some_and(|value| value.is_null()),
                "a Variant NULL default must surface as a null scalar",
            );
        }
    }

    Ok(())
}

/// Defaults kernel cannot materialize surface via raw SQL so the connector can evaluate them.
#[rstest]
#[case::type_mismatch("type_mismatch", DataType::INTEGER, "'not an int'")]
#[case::non_primitive(
    "non_primitive",
    DataType::from(ArrayType::new(DataType::INTEGER, true)),
    "ARRAY(1)"
)]
#[tokio::test]
async fn test_load_tolerates_unmaterializable_default(
    #[case] label: &str,
    #[case] data_type: DataType,
    #[case] default_sql: &str,
) -> Result<(),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
    let base = schema! { nullable "c": (data_type) };
    let schema = schema_with_column_defaults(&base, HashMap::from([("c", default_sql)]))?;

    let (engine, table_url) = setup_unpartitioned_table(
        &format!("test_load_{label}_default"),
        schema,
        vec!["allowColumnDefaults"],
    )
    .await?;

    let snapshot = Snapshot::builder_for(table_url).build(&engine)?;
    let txn = snapshot.transaction(Box::new(FileSystemCommitter::new()), &engine)?;
    let defaults = txn.top_level_column_defaults()?;

    let c = &defaults["c"];
    assert_eq!(c.raw_sql(), default_sql);
    assert_eq!(
        c.to_scalar()?,
        None,
        "kernel must leave an unmaterializable default to the connector"
    );

    Ok(())
}
